    Core responsibilities include, but are not limited to:

    + Complete required quality record review, such as laboratory documentation, CCP, PC, and other documentation.

    + Write, review, and implement quality assurance procedures.

    + Recommend modifications or upgrades to testing procedures or equipment. Coordinate the procurement of items required for the lab.

    + Assist the quality manager and partner with operations with the pathogen environmental monitoring (PEM) program, including oversight of the swabbing program, investigation/corrective actions, and mitigation activities.

    + Provide regular training, instruction, and guidance to employees on matters of food safety, quality, and compliance

    + Initiate and drive continuous improvement activities, and partner with all facility functions to resolve persistent challenges while supporting the implementation of new procedures or processes.

    + Support customer, regulatory, and third-party quality and food safety audits.

    + Investigate, find solutions, and implement remedies to quality issues and customer complaints

    + Support and maintain existing certifications (e.g., SQF, Kosher, Halal, Organic).

    + Supervise hourly employees’ activities to meet or exceed the standards and specifications established by quality assurance and the organization.

    + Ensure all process, product, or infrastructure changes are understood by employees in a timely fashion.

    + Identify and retain highly effective personnel through proper selection, training, and establishing expectations.

    + Develop and implement material standards with appropriate control and inspection procedures to improve product quality and reduce rework/downtime.

    + Maintain close surveillance over inspection/testing procedures and corresponding results to ensure the finished product is food-safe and meets customer expectations.

    + Support the analysis of quality data to assess product performance and utilize statistical process control (SPC) tools to identify and react to unfavorable trends.

    + Complete supervisory activities such as administering employee promotions and transfers; reviewing and editing employee timekeeping; completing performance evaluations; mentoring, training, and coaching employees.

    + Follow all DFA good manufacturing practices (GMP) and work in a manner consistent with all corporate regulatory, food safety, quality, and sanitation requirements.

    Requirements

    + Bachelor of Science degree in food science, biological sciences, or related field preferred. Will consider a minimum of 4+ years of experience in lieu of a degree.

    + 2-5 years of experience in a quality department with knowledge and experience in labs and sanitation departments.

    + A minimum of 2 years of experience in a lead or supervisory role.

    + Dairy experience is preferred, seeking a candidate with work experience in the food and beverage industry.

    + Certification and/or license – PCQI, HACCP, SQF Practitioner certifications preferred; may be required during the course of employment.

    + Ability to calibrate a variety of testing equipment.

    + Strong computer proficiency with MS Office (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Outlook)

    + Ability to work in temperature-controlled environments typical of dairy production, including areas as cold as 32°F
